LA Galaxy foe Dwayne De Rosario retires, but was his goal against the Galaxy the best in MLS history?

CARSON, Calif. -- Famed LA Galaxy rival Dwayne De Rosario announced his retirement via social media on Sunday after an 18-year career. 


The all-time leading goal scorer for Canada, De Rosario earned a host of honors in Major League Soccer including four MLS Cups, six MLS Best XI's, seven MLS All-Star appearances, and one MLS MVP (2011). During his time in MLS, De Rosario suited up for the San Jose Earthquakes (2001-05), Houston Dynamo (2006-08), Toronto FC (2009-11), New York Red Bulls (2011), D.C. United (2011-13), and Toronto FC once more. (2014).


The greatness of "DeRo" is unquestioned but for our purposes, De Rosario's finest moment may have come on October 15, 2006 when he scored a beautiful bending goal for the San Jose Earthquakes against the LA Galaxy.
